fix testing for supporting event-reporter
This commit is contained in:
parent
3bec928dd7
commit
d996fc0c02
8 changed files with 97 additions and 24 deletions
2
.github/configs/ct-install.yaml
vendored
2
.github/configs/ct-install.yaml
vendored
|
@ -6,7 +6,7 @@ charts:
|
||||||
- charts/argo-cd
|
- charts/argo-cd
|
||||||
chart-repos:
|
chart-repos:
|
||||||
- dandydeveloper=https://dandydeveloper.github.io/charts/
|
- dandydeveloper=https://dandydeveloper.github.io/charts/
|
||||||
helm-extra-args: "--timeout 600s"
|
helm-extra-args: "--timeout 600s"
|
||||||
validate-chart-schema: false
|
validate-chart-schema: false
|
||||||
validate-maintainers: true
|
validate-maintainers: true
|
||||||
validate-yaml: true
|
validate-yaml: true
|
||||||
|
|
2
.github/workflows/lint-and-test.yml
vendored
2
.github/workflows/lint-and-test.yml
vendored
|
@ -90,4 +90,4 @@ jobs:
|
||||||
|
|
||||||
- name: Run chart-testing (install)
|
- name: Run chart-testing (install)
|
||||||
run: ct install --config ./.github/configs/ct-install.yaml --target-branch ${{ github.base_ref }}
|
run: ct install --config ./.github/configs/ct-install.yaml --target-branch ${{ github.base_ref }}
|
||||||
if: steps.list-changed.outputs.changed == 'true'
|
if: steps.list-changed.outputs.changed == 'true'
|
||||||
|
|
|
@ -2,7 +2,19 @@
|
||||||
crds:
|
crds:
|
||||||
keep: false
|
keep: false
|
||||||
|
|
||||||
# these tests only support vanilla argo-cd
|
# needed for correct work of event reporter component
|
||||||
# do not work for event reporter component
|
extraObjects:
|
||||||
eventReporter:
|
- apiVersion: v1
|
||||||
enabled: false
|
kind: Secret
|
||||||
|
metadata:
|
||||||
|
name: argocd-token
|
||||||
|
type: Opaque
|
||||||
|
data:
|
||||||
|
token: c29tZS10ZXN0LXBhc3N3b3Jk # some-test-password
|
||||||
|
- apiVersion: v1
|
||||||
|
kind: Secret
|
||||||
|
metadata:
|
||||||
|
name: codefresh-token
|
||||||
|
type: Opaque
|
||||||
|
data:
|
||||||
|
token: c29tZS10ZXN0LXBhc3N3b3Jk # some-test-password
|
||||||
|
|
|
@ -7,5 +7,18 @@ controller:
|
||||||
|
|
||||||
# these tests only support vanilla argo-cd
|
# these tests only support vanilla argo-cd
|
||||||
# do not work for event reporter component
|
# do not work for event reporter component
|
||||||
eventReporter:
|
extraObjects:
|
||||||
enabled: false
|
- apiVersion: v1
|
||||||
|
kind: Secret
|
||||||
|
metadata:
|
||||||
|
name: argocd-token
|
||||||
|
type: Opaque
|
||||||
|
data:
|
||||||
|
token: c29tZS10ZXN0LXBhc3N3b3Jk # some-test-password
|
||||||
|
- apiVersion: v1
|
||||||
|
kind: Secret
|
||||||
|
metadata:
|
||||||
|
name: codefresh-token
|
||||||
|
type: Opaque
|
||||||
|
data:
|
||||||
|
token: c29tZS10ZXN0LXBhc3N3b3Jk # some-test-password
|
||||||
|
|
|
@ -13,7 +13,19 @@ server:
|
||||||
- name: EXTENSION_CHECKSUM_URL
|
- name: EXTENSION_CHECKSUM_URL
|
||||||
value: https://github.com/argoproj-labs/argocd-extension-metrics/releases/download/v1.0.0/extension_checksums.txt
|
value: https://github.com/argoproj-labs/argocd-extension-metrics/releases/download/v1.0.0/extension_checksums.txt
|
||||||
|
|
||||||
# these tests only support vanilla argo-cd
|
# needed for correct work of event reporter component
|
||||||
# do not work for event reporter component
|
extraObjects:
|
||||||
eventReporter:
|
- apiVersion: v1
|
||||||
enabled: false
|
kind: Secret
|
||||||
|
metadata:
|
||||||
|
name: argocd-token
|
||||||
|
type: Opaque
|
||||||
|
data:
|
||||||
|
token: c29tZS10ZXN0LXBhc3N3b3Jk # some-test-password
|
||||||
|
- apiVersion: v1
|
||||||
|
kind: Secret
|
||||||
|
metadata:
|
||||||
|
name: codefresh-token
|
||||||
|
type: Opaque
|
||||||
|
data:
|
||||||
|
token: c29tZS10ZXN0LXBhc3N3b3Jk # some-test-password
|
||||||
|
|
|
@ -11,7 +11,19 @@ externalRedis:
|
||||||
host: "redis-master.redis.svc.cluster.local"
|
host: "redis-master.redis.svc.cluster.local"
|
||||||
password: "argocd"
|
password: "argocd"
|
||||||
|
|
||||||
# these tests only support vanilla argo-cd
|
# needed for correct work of event reporter component
|
||||||
# do not work for event reporter component
|
extraObjects:
|
||||||
eventReporter:
|
- apiVersion: v1
|
||||||
enabled: false
|
kind: Secret
|
||||||
|
metadata:
|
||||||
|
name: argocd-token
|
||||||
|
type: Opaque
|
||||||
|
data:
|
||||||
|
token: c29tZS10ZXN0LXBhc3N3b3Jk # some-test-password
|
||||||
|
- apiVersion: v1
|
||||||
|
kind: Secret
|
||||||
|
metadata:
|
||||||
|
name: codefresh-token
|
||||||
|
type: Opaque
|
||||||
|
data:
|
||||||
|
token: c29tZS10ZXN0LXBhc3N3b3Jk # some-test-password
|
||||||
|
|
|
@ -15,7 +15,19 @@ repoServer:
|
||||||
enabled: true
|
enabled: true
|
||||||
minReplicas: 2
|
minReplicas: 2
|
||||||
|
|
||||||
# these tests only support vanilla argo-cd
|
# needed for correct work of event reporter component
|
||||||
# do not work for event reporter component
|
extraObjects:
|
||||||
eventReporter:
|
- apiVersion: v1
|
||||||
enabled: false
|
kind: Secret
|
||||||
|
metadata:
|
||||||
|
name: argocd-token
|
||||||
|
type: Opaque
|
||||||
|
data:
|
||||||
|
token: c29tZS10ZXN0LXBhc3N3b3Jk # some-test-password
|
||||||
|
- apiVersion: v1
|
||||||
|
kind: Secret
|
||||||
|
metadata:
|
||||||
|
name: codefresh-token
|
||||||
|
type: Opaque
|
||||||
|
data:
|
||||||
|
token: c29tZS10ZXN0LXBhc3N3b3Jk # some-test-password
|
||||||
|
|
|
@ -11,7 +11,19 @@ server:
|
||||||
repoServer:
|
repoServer:
|
||||||
replicas: 2
|
replicas: 2
|
||||||
|
|
||||||
# these tests only support vanilla argo-cd
|
# needed for correct work of event reporter component
|
||||||
# do not work for event reporter component
|
extraObjects:
|
||||||
eventReporter:
|
- apiVersion: v1
|
||||||
enabled: false
|
kind: Secret
|
||||||
|
metadata:
|
||||||
|
name: argocd-token
|
||||||
|
type: Opaque
|
||||||
|
data:
|
||||||
|
token: c29tZS10ZXN0LXBhc3N3b3Jk # some-test-password
|
||||||
|
- apiVersion: v1
|
||||||
|
kind: Secret
|
||||||
|
metadata:
|
||||||
|
name: codefresh-token
|
||||||
|
type: Opaque
|
||||||
|
data:
|
||||||
|
token: c29tZS10ZXN0LXBhc3N3b3Jk # some-test-password
|
||||||
|
|
Loading…
Reference in a new issue